Tesla remembers 30,000 Model X autos over air bag concern

Elon Musk’s Tesla remembered almost 30,000 Model X autos in the United States over a concern that might trigger the front guest air bag to release inaccurately, sending its shares down almost 3% on Friday to their most affordable in almost 2 years.

The air bag can release inaccurately in specific low-speed crash occasions where a young pole position guest is unbelted as well as out of setting, raising the threat of injury, the firm stated in a declaring with regulatory authorities.

Tesla stated it was not familiar with any type of fatalities, collisions or injuries associated with the recall.

The issue will certainly be dealt with with an over-the-air software application upgrade, the firm stated in a letter submitted with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ration.

Earlier this month, the globe’s most important car manufacturer remembered over 40,000 Model S as well as Model X cars as a result of the threat of experiencing a loss of power guiding aid when driving on harsh roadways or after striking a pit.

Tesla shares struck a 52-week low of $176.55 on Friday prior to shutting at $180.19, down 1.6%.
